For those of you who think you may keep your current PC thru the year
2000, it might behoove you to go to National Software Testing
Laboratories:
        
        http://www.nstl.com/


and pick up their  FREE YMark 2000 program.  The program tests whether
your hardware (mainly BIOS) properly rolls over. Read the README file
carefully, because it explains why manually setting the date to test the
roll over can fool you, although it is a reasonable way to test software
roll over.


My Compaq Presario CDS 924 fails the test.  I have written to Compaq
requesting a BIOS update.
